在CSS样式表中,我们经常需要对文字的开头添加适当的背景色来起到突出显示的效果。但是,对于不同的元素,实现这一效果的方式可能会有所不同。要为一段文字的开头设置背景颜色,我们可以使用“::firstle...
在CSS样式表中,我们经常需要对文字的开头添加适当的背景色来起到突出显示的效果。但是,对于不同的元素,实现这一效果的方式可能会有所不同。
要为一段文字的开头设置背景颜色,我们可以使用“::first-letter”伪元素。这个伪元素可以选择文本块的第一个字母或数字,并为其设置样式。
p::first-letter {
background-color: #ff0000;
color: #ffffff;
padding: 5px;
font-size: 2em;
} 在上述代码中,我们使用了“p::first-letter”来表示对所有p标签中第一个字母的样式设置。我们为这个开头的字母设置了背景颜色为红色,字体颜色为白色,上下左右各自增加了5px的内边距,同时将字体大小设置为原来的两倍。
需要注意的是,这种方法只能对字母或数字有效,而对于符号等其他字符则不起作用。同时,在设置首字母样式的时候需要注意对字体大小的调整,以免影响整个段落的排版。